S 86 (36) Al-Tariq

1 By the sky and Al-Tariq. 2 And what will make you know what Al-Tariq is? 3 The piercing star. 4 There is no soul but a keeper is over it. 5 So let man see from what he was created. 6 He was created from water pouring out. 7 Coming out from between the backbone and the upper ribs. 8 He is capable of returning him. 9 On a day the secrets are tested. 10 Then he has no power or helper. 11 By the sky, the same return, 12 By the Earth, the same crack. 13 It is conclusive speech. 14 And it is not in jocularity. 15 They scheme a scheme 16 And I scheme a scheme. 17 So be leisurely with the kafirun. Give them time slowly.
